Senior iOS Engineer
Intellectual Capital Resources
In this role you will own the iOS architecture and delivery for a high-performance mobile product that supports IoT, GPS, and computer vision. You will work closely with Robotics and Computer Vision engineers to deliver a resilient, low-latency native app and seamless hardware integrations over Bluetooth. You’ll optimize sensor-fusion and manage real-time data on mobile hardware, balancing performance with power. This is a pivotal position in a fast-growing team aiming to scale impact for millions of users.
Responsibilities- Own and architect the iOS system and maintain a high-performance native application using Swift, SwiftUI, and modern concurrency patterns
- Develop seamless hardware integrations via Bluetooth (Core Bluetooth, BLE)
- Collaborate with Robotics and Computer Vision engineers to align software with hardware and algorithms
- Optimize sensor-fusion algorithms and solvers (e.g., Ceres) for real-time mobile execution
- Manage memory, threading, and ARM constraints to ensure low-latency, high-uptime performance
- Integrate low-level C++ and/or Rust codebases with the iOS frontend (Swift/SwiftUI)
- Work with time-series and high-frequency data and potentially fleets of edge devices in IoT/Robotics
- Design and maintain highly resilient systems with minimal downtime and latency
